An Anatomical Disquisition on the Motion of the Heart & Blood in Animals
William Harvey's "An Anatomical Disquisition on the Motion of the Heart & Blood in Animals" (1628) is a groundbreaking work that radically transformed the understanding of human physiology and anatomy. This seminal text employs a meticulous empirical approach and integrates detailed anatomical observations with a passionate philosophical inquiry into the nature of life itself. Harvey's use of clear, methodical prose, combined with authoritative empirical evidence, challenges existing notions of blood movement and posits the revolutionary theory of circulation, wherein blood is propelled through a closed system by the heart'—a concept that vastly altered the landscape of medical science. Harvey, trained in both medicine and philosophy, was deeply influenced by the scientific discoveries of the Renaissance. His exposure to the works of anatomists and his own dissections contributed to his revolutionary ideas. Bridging the gulf between medieval scholasticism and modern science, Harvey's endeavors reflect the Enlightenment's spirit of inquiry and emphasize observation over tradition, showcasing his commitment to advancing human understanding of biology and medicine.
